2. HubSpot's Native LinkedIn Ads Integration

What it is: This is HubSpot's official, built-in integration focused exclusively on LinkedIn Ads. Its purpose is to capture leads generated from LinkedIn Lead Gen Forms.

How it provides a HubSpot LinkedIn integration:

  • It automatically syncs lead data from your LinkedIn Ad campaigns into your HubSpot portal.

  • When a user fills out a Lead Gen Form on LinkedIn, a new contact is created in HubSpot with the submitted information.

  • You can then use HubSpot lists and workflows to nurture these leads automatically.

Best for: Marketing teams running paid advertising campaigns on LinkedIn who need to get leads into their CRM quickly.

Pros:

  • Seamless and reliable for its specific purpose

  • Easy to set up within the HubSpot platform

  • Free to use

Cons:

  • Does not sync profiles, DMs, or any organic activity. This is not the solution for sales outreach or conversation tracking.

3. LinkedIn Sales Navigator Integration

What it is: This is the premium integration that allows HubSpot to connect with LinkedIn's flagship sales tool, Sales Navigator. It's designed to enrich HubSpot contacts with LinkedIn data.

How it provides a HubSpot LinkedIn integration:

  • Contact Enrichment: Sync LinkedIn profile data (job title, company, location) to HubSpot contacts with a single click from a LinkedIn profile.

  • In-HubSpot Insights: View Sales Navigator insights like mutual connections, related leads, and job change alerts directly within a HubSpot contact record.

  • Workflow Triggers: According to HubBase research, you can trigger HubSpot workflows based on Sales Nav activities, such as "New Lead Identified" or "Lead Engagement Detected."

  • Send InMail from HubSpot: You can send InMail messages directly from a contact's record in HubSpot, and the activity is logged on their timeline.

Best for: Sales teams heavily invested in Account-Based Selling (ABM) who already pay for Sales Navigator Team or Enterprise licenses.

Pros:

  • Provides valuable account and lead intelligence within the CRM

  • Streamlines the initial process of creating a new contact in HubSpot from a LinkedIn profile

Cons:

  • As users point out, it requires an expensive Sales Navigator subscription

  • The sync is often limited. It logs sent InMails but doesn't provide a real-time, two-way sync of the entire conversation thread, which is a major pain point

4. Zapier

What it is: Zapier is a no-code automation tool that acts as a middleman, connecting thousands of apps, including HubSpot and LinkedIn.

How it provides a HubSpot LinkedIn integration:

  • It uses a "trigger-and-action" system. For example, a trigger in HubSpot can cause an action on LinkedIn.

  • Popular "Zaps" (Workflows):

    1. Trigger: New Blog Post in HubSpot -> Action: Share article as a company update on LinkedIn.

    2. Trigger: New Contact in HubSpot -> Action: Add contact to a LinkedIn Matched Audience for ad targeting.

    3. Trigger: New Form Submission in HubSpot -> Action: Create a LinkedIn company update.

  • Trusted by 87% of Forbes Cloud 100 companies, Zapier is a reliable choice for automating public-facing marketing tasks.

Best for: Marketing teams looking to automate content distribution and lead routing between their HubSpot portal and their LinkedIn Company Page.

Pros:

  • Incredibly flexible and connects to thousands of other tools

  • No-code interface is easy for non-developers to use

  • Great for automating top-of-funnel marketing activities

Cons:

  • Not designed for personal profile interactions. It cannot read, send, or sync DMs from your personal LinkedIn account. It doesn't solve the sales conversation management problem

5. Make.com

What it is: A powerful workflow automation platform similar to Zapier, but often preferred for more complex, multi-step, and conditional automation scenarios.

How it provides a HubSpot LinkedIn integration:

  • Make allows for more advanced orchestration where you can build sophisticated outbound motions.

  • Example Workflow from LaGrowthMachine:

    1. Monitor HubSpot List: Make watches a specific HubSpot list (e.g., Lifecycle Stage = "Lead").

    2. Enrich Lead: When a new lead appears, Make uses HubSpot's "CRM objects" to find the associated company and enrich the contact record.

    3. Conditional Logic: Based on the data, it can route the lead into different automated sequences (e.g., an email + LinkedIn campaign).

Best for: Tech-savvy marketing or sales ops teams who need to build custom, multi-channel workflows with conditional logic that go beyond simple trigger-action rules.

Pros:

  • Visually intuitive workflow builder

  • Handles complex, multi-step scenarios better than many alternatives

  • Often more cost-effective for high-volume tasks compared to Zapier

Cons:

  • Steeper learning curve than Zapier

  • Like Zapier, it primarily interacts with LinkedIn Company Pages and Ads, not personal DMs

6. Oktopost

What it is: Oktopost is a B2B social media management platform designed for marketing teams. Its focus is on content scheduling, employee advocacy, and measuring the ROI of social media activities.

How it provides a HubSpot LinkedIn integration:

  • The integration is centered around marketing analytics. It tracks how engagement with LinkedIn posts (from company pages or employee advocates) influences lead generation and pipeline in HubSpot.

  • It attributes leads and opportunities in HubSpot back to the specific social media posts that generated them, giving marketers clear ROI data.

Best for: Enterprise B2B marketing teams that need to manage a large-scale social media presence and prove its impact on the sales pipeline within HubSpot.

Pros:

  • Excellent for measuring the business impact of social media marketing

  • Strong employee advocacy features

Cons:

  • This is a marketing analytics tool, not a sales engagement or HubSpot LinkedIn integration tool for managing DMs or syncing individual contacts. It serves a completely different purpose.

Why doesn't the native HubSpot integration sync my DMs?

The native HubSpot and LinkedIn Sales Navigator integrations are not designed to sync personal direct messages (DMs). HubSpot's native tool focuses exclusively on capturing leads from LinkedIn Ads. The Sales Navigator integration is built to enrich HubSpot contacts with profile data and log sent InMails, but it does not track or sync the back-and-forth replies, leaving a significant gap in conversation history.

What's the difference between a marketing vs. a sales HubSpot LinkedIn integration?

The primary difference lies in their purpose. Marketing integrations (like Zapier, Make.com, or Oktopost) focus on top-of-funnel activities such as automating content distribution to company pages, capturing ad leads, and measuring the ROI of social media campaigns. Sales integrations (like Kondo or the Sales Navigator integration) are focused on bottom-of-funnel activities, such as syncing individual conversations, enriching contact data for outreach, and logging sales activities within the CRM.
